An easy and affordable choice for winter

According to The Sun: With winter approaching, people are actively looking for an alternative to popular hot chocolate, but at a much lower price.

Customers are impressed by the new version of Hotel Chocolat’s Velvetiser, introduced at B&M.

B&M

The premium product costs a whopping £100, while the budget option is sold for just £25.

The Heat & Eat Hot Chocolate Maker is available in two colors – copper and black – and could make a wonderful Christmas gift.

This budget version performs the same function without causing financial strain.

The instructions state: “Just add milk (dairy or plant-based) and your chosen hot chocolate. It creates smooth hot chocolate every time with 4 different settings. Easy to clean, has a non-stick surface and a removable whisk.”
